The Supply Chain Analyst I role is responsible for the execution, continuous improvement, and problem-solving of supply chain processes to achieve business results. This role requires understanding downstream customer requirements to meet expectations and drives change by applying fundamental theories, principles, and concepts of supply chain and lean manufacturing. The analyst will optimize plans and schedules in a lean environment, including coordinating services and materials to match production demands. They will analyze and communicate value stream and/or supply chain capacity and constraints, take ownership in performing root cause analysis, and drive corrective actions across the supply chain using tools such as ERP, Kanban, spike tools, and 5Y. Collaboration with internal and external partners, including suppliers, supervisors, team leads, logistics/warehouse groups, and material planners, is essential. The role represents supply chain in projects within the value stream (plan, source, make, or deliver) and provides coaching and mentoring to supply chain planners. Receives minimal guidance from others.
